With the innovative system cabling, we supply the complete connection system for the controller families SIMATIC S7-300 and S7-400. You can choose between two versions:

More efficient cabling made easy:

SIMATIC TOP connect

A fault-free and reliable connection between the individual components of an electronic plant is the main prerequisite for its function. Conventional wiring such as single line wiring with terminal blocks is often complex and fault-prone – and in larger plants usually very confusing. SIMATIC TOP connect proves that this can be done differently.

the fully modular connection accord-ing to the buildaccord-ing block principle and the flexible connection with bundled single wires. In any case, tangled cables, mixed-up contacts and time-consuming troubleshooting are a thing of the past thanks to SIMATIC TOP connect – result-ing in considerably increased efficiency when cabling.

For a reliable and quick connection: the front connector module

The front connector module is not a front connector which has been subsequently modified for the SIMATIC S7, it is rather a special development with IDC socket contacts for the easy connection of the connecting cable - fully enclosed for protection against dust in industrial envi-ronments. The original accessory of our PLCs is of course available in the usual SIMATIC quality and adapted to the latest development of the S7-300 or S7-400. Depending on the design, it permits the connection of 2 or 4 connecting cables with 8 channels each incl. power supply via IDC connectors. The front connector module makes the time-consuming and fault-prone connection of up to 40 cores per module unnecessary. The power supply is also accessible via spring-loaded or screw terminals. Furthermore, the SIMATIC S7-300 front connector module offers a special feature for 20-pole mod-ules: It can be placed into a pre-engaged position for activating – thus SIMATIC is ready for operation even faster.

Perfectly matched to each other:

the fully modular connection

In conventional solutions, sensors and

actuators of the machine or plant are connected to the control electronics in the control cabinet via terminal blocks. Compact connection modules are used instead of terminal blocks for connect-ing to SIMATIC S7. The advantage of this method: input/output modules are not connected with the terminal boxes via fault-prone single line wiring but instead via attachable cables. Furthermore, the connection modules are not

only the electrical interface between control cabinet and machine, but they also permit voltage and performance adaptation.

The fully modular connection minimizes the wiring overhead and avoids errors that may occur in single line wiring due to polarity reversal on the front con-nector and terminal box. Furthermore, connection modules with signal condi-tioning reduce the overhead even more since wiring of further components, e.g. individual coupling relays, is no longer necessary.

In addition, the uniform and clear con-nection diagram reduces testing periods and, if necessary, facilitates troubleshoot-ing. Configuring is easier and faster due to the use of standard components.

High level of integrated functionality: the connection module

The compact connection modules for standard rail mounting are available with different functionalities. They permit a uniform connection concept even if there are many different requirements. The cost-optimized connection modules are available in the following designs: Basic module, signal module, function module.

With all connection modules you can reduce the wiring overhead even more because the supply voltage can be simply looped through via additional terminals. Since all connections are on the same lev-el, screwdrivers and wires can be inserted from one direction. Thus the connecting wires can be easily attached and screwed in place even in poor lighting conditions. The new optocoupler module offers you special advantages: The compact con-nection module is suitable for very high switching sequences up to 500 Hz and switches load currents up to 4 A. In the case of an overload or open circuit at one of the 8 outputs, a red LED is illuminated and a group fault signalling contact is trigged. Any faults can thus be detected and eliminated more quickly, which in turn increases the availability.

Custom-tailored and pre-assembled: the connecting cable

You can choose the type of connecting cable: custom-tailored for self-assembly or ready for plugging in. In any case it can transfer signals from 8 channels each or 1 byte and additionally handle the power supply. The I/O modules are thus supplied with electric potential via the connection modules – without additional wiring. Furthermore, the cable also wires a 16-channel module to a cable by means of two flat ribbon cables for self-assem-bly. Cable versions with braided copper shields ensure the transfer of sensitive analogue signals without interference. The custom-tailored version of the flat round cable can be easily cut to length to meet your individual requirements. For this purpose, you only need to attach the IDC connectors to the cable ends - and you’re done. Cable entries are imple-mented just as easily and the cores are optimally protected by the cable jacket. The IDC connector can be attached after the cable entry. The ready-to-connect version with pre-assembled round cables is more convenient and can be connected faster. The IDC connectors are already attached to the 16-pole round cable. You only need to connect the round cable to the front connector module and the con-nection module.

Simple and convincing:

the flexible connection

The flexible connection consists of clearly bundled individual wires which are direct-ly connected to the front connector via crimp or screw-type terminals. With a cross-section of 0.5 mm2 they can also transfer higher currents. The individual cores can be routed to any element in the control cabinet – quickly, easily, and flexibly. Each core is clearly marked by a printed number according to the connection point of the module. Mix-ups are thus prevented and the cabinet interior remains organized and clearly arranged. Should a cable become dam-aged, it can be replaced quickly.

By the way: the individual wires are also available as UL/CSA version to facilitate export.
